Oh, those angels from Victoria’s Secrets. They are not infallible, nor are they sports fans of the Big 10 conference. If finding the elusive APEC aloha shirts is too tough, you might want to search for this mistake.
See this Michigan State Spartans-themed shirt produced by Victoria’s Secrets? Color’s right, emblem’s correct, but the motto “Hail to the Victors,” well that ain’t right. That saying belongs to rival University of Michigan Wolverines.
I guess angels can make mistakes.

So you take professional pictures at a portrait studio, and you want to use one of these shots for a Christmas card. Can you design a card using one of these pictures and mass produce them at Costco?
Supposedly yes, if you get the release and photo consent forms from the portrait studio (by purchasing the portrait). But what does a typical consent form look like? I don’t think it’s an .ini file on a burned CD that contains the image. But that’s what we’re being told is the consent form. I’m no Microsoft Windows expert, but don’t .ini files contain configuration settings for apps? Using a text editor, the .ini file looks like a typical “innie” file with a bunch of parameters and their values.
I’ll see what happens when I take a print out of this .ini file (as instructed by the portrait studio) to Costco to authorize the release of our Christmas cards. Maybe Costco won’t even check? I’m not sure how this works, but I’ll find out soon enough.
